Germantown High has a lot of new teachers this year, one of them being 10th grade English
teacher Felicia Munn. This is a whole new experience for her because it’s her first year teaching high
school students.
“High schoolers are better engaged. They realize that they really need to be on task and get
prepared for college so they’re hungry. They want to know what’s going to be on the EOC test and how
they can pass the ACT test and that’s what makes me excited about teaching,” stated Munn.
Q: What school did you teach at before you came to Germantown High?
A: I taught at Treadwell Middle School. It is in the Highland Heights area near University of Memphis.
Q: What do you like about teaching?
A: I love getting students excited about English, especially those who previously thought English was
boring. I love showing them how they can get enriched through words.
Q: How long have you been teaching?
A: I’ve been teaching since 2007.
Q: How do you like Germantown High School?
A: I couldn’t be in a better place.
